However, upon her arrival in Northern Lin, Zongzheng Wuyou refuses to marry Rong Le.
Princess Rong Le is set up as an owner of a tea house under the alias of Man Yao to collect information about it, find it and bring it back to Western Qi.
When Prince Wuyou, finally, realizes Man Yao's true identity, they are forced to separate when Princess Rong Le’s brother Emperor Rong Qi suddenly shows up and forces her to marry the powerful General Fu Chou.
Everything turns into chaos with new enemies, revenge, double crosses, wars, new alliances, new truths, new lies and betrayals.
Princess Rong Le must find out her true identity and try to save both kingdoms from war.
